If you used using Ainers guide to get up and running
http://www.ainer.org/?p=747
Then the created init.d script (following his guide) has an updater you can run from commandline.
Just type
Quote:/etc/init.d/sickbeard.sh update
That stops sickbeard running, backups your current version to a backup directory, downloads the new one, installs, and restarts (keeping your configs and database).
